Definitions:

Psychological Well-being

Psychological well-being refers to the state of an individual's mental health, encompassing emotional, cognitive, and social aspects of happiness and contentment.

Peer Relationships

The interactions and bonds formed between individuals of similar age groups, which play a significant role in social and emotional development.

Military Violence

Acts of aggression and force carried out by armed forces, often in the context of conflict or war.

Sibling Rivalry

Competition, jealousy, and conflict between brothers and sisters, often for parental attention and approval.
